Browse Source

修改问答

wjj 6 ngày trước cách đây
mục cha
commit
683f36207d
2 tập tin đã thay đổi với 15 bổ sung15 xóa
  1. 8 8
      src/views/his/answer/index.vue
  2. 7 7
      src/views/his/package/index.vue

+ 8 - 8
src/views/his/answer/index.vue

@@ -1,11 +1,11 @@
 <template>
   <div class="app-container">
-    <el-form :model="queryParams" ref="queryForm" :inline="true" v-show="showSearch" label-width="68px">
+    <!-- <el-form :model="queryParams" ref="queryForm" :inline="true" v-show="showSearch" label-width="68px">
       <el-form-item>
         <el-button type="primary" icon="el-icon-search" size="mini" @click="handleQuery">搜索</el-button>
         <el-button icon="el-icon-refresh" size="mini" @click="resetQuery">重置</el-button>
       </el-form-item>
-    </el-form>
+    </el-form> -->
 
     <el-row :gutter="10" class="mb8">
       <el-col :span="1.5">
@@ -94,7 +94,7 @@
             <div v-for="(option, optionIndex) in answer.options" :key="optionIndex" class="option-item">
               <div class="option-input">
                 <el-input 
-                  v-model="answer.options[optionIndex]" 
+                  v-model="answer.options[optionIndex].name" 
                   :placeholder="`选项 ${optionIndex + 1}`">
                 </el-input>
               </div>
@@ -195,7 +195,7 @@ export default {
             answers: [
               {
                 title: '',
-                options: ['']
+                options: [{name:'',value:0}]
               }
             ]
           },
@@ -216,7 +216,7 @@ export default {
     addItem(length) {
           this.form.answers.push({
             title: '',
-            options: ['']
+            options: [{name:'',value:0}]
           })
         },
         delItem(item, index) {
@@ -242,7 +242,7 @@ export default {
           }
         },
         addOption(answerIndex, optionIndex) {
-          this.form.answers[answerIndex].options.push('')
+          this.form.answers[answerIndex].options.push({name:'',value:optionIndex + 1})
         },
         delOption(options, index) {
           if (options.length > 1) {
@@ -330,7 +330,7 @@ export default {
         this.form = {
           answers: [{
             title: '',
-            options: ['']
+            options: [{name:'',value:0}]
           }
 
           ]
@@ -347,7 +347,7 @@ export default {
           this.form = {
             answers: [{
               title: '',
-              options: []
+              options: [{name:'',value:0}]
             }
 
             ]

+ 7 - 7
src/views/his/package/index.vue

@@ -569,7 +569,7 @@
             />
           </el-select>
         </el-form-item>
-        <el-form-item label="问答" prop="questionId" >
+        <!-- <el-form-item label="问答" prop="questionId" >
            <el-select v-model="form.questionId" placeholder="请选择问答">
               <el-option
                   v-for="dict in questionOptions"
@@ -578,7 +578,7 @@
                   :value="parseInt(dict.dictValue)"
                 />
            </el-select>
-        </el-form-item>
+        </el-form-item> -->
       </el-form>
       <div slot="footer" class="dialog-footer">
         <el-button type="primary" @click="submitForm">确 定</el-button>
@@ -663,7 +663,7 @@ import {
 import {getAllFollowTempName } from "@/api/his/followTemp";
 import {getAllCateList} from "@/api/his/packageCate";
 import {allIcd } from "@/api/his/icd";
-import {questionOptions } from "@/api/his/answer";
+// import {questionOptions } from "@/api/his/answer";
 import packageDetails from '../../components/his/packageDetails.vue';
 import productAttrValueSelect from "../../components/his/productAttrValueSelect.vue";
 import { listStore } from "@/api/his/storeProduct";
@@ -713,7 +713,7 @@ export default {
               url: process.env.VUE_APP_BASE_API + "/his/package/importData"
             },
       productTypeOptions: [],
-      questionOptions: [],
+      // questionOptions: [],
       storeId:null,
       storeOPtions:[],
       usageFrequencyUnitOptions:[{
@@ -868,9 +868,9 @@ export default {
     listStore().then(response => {
       this.storeOPtions = response.rows;
     });
-    questionOptions().then(res => {
-      this.questionOptions = res.rows;
-    })
+    // questionOptions().then(res => {
+    //   this.questionOptions = res.rows;
+    // })
   },
   methods: {
     getSolarTermLabel(solarTerm) {